Loving someone in recovery isn’t about having all the right answers, it’s about showing up.
It can look like:
• Listening without trying to fix
• Setting healthy boundaries
• Celebrating progress (even when it’s quiet or imperfect)
• Choosing patience over judgment on the hard days
It’s not about perfection.
It’s about consistency, honesty, and care, more than saying the “right” thing.
And remember: supporting someone else also means taking care of yourself.
Love works best when it’s balanced.
